Hi Ray. One possibility might be improper assembly of the transceiver that is causing the transistors to not mate properly with the heatsink on the bottom chassis.
Been there... done that. :-) Here's the story behind repeated 2SC1969 failures in my K2 back in 2003, and the mechanics behind the cause: http://mailman.qth.net/pipermail/elecraft/2003-September/023145.html http://mailman.qth.net/pipermail/elecraft/2003-September/023307.html There were never any over-current issues, and it took several transistor replacements before I realized the problem was due to the incorrect placement of the lock washers associated with the 2-D fasteners.
